QUESTION 2 :- What are some specific fundamental rights mentioned in the Indian Constitution? Introduction: In the fascinating world of the Indian Constitution, there’s a special chapter called “Fundamental Rights,” and it’s like the superhero section ensuring that every citizen has their own set of superpowers. Imagine it as a guarantee card for your personal freedoms and fairness. The Indian Constitution promises to protect its people and make sure everyone is treated equally and justly. Now, let’s dive into the specifics of these fundamental rights – the rights that make you feel like a superhero in your own life! Specific Fundamental Rights in the Indian Constitution: Right to Equality (Articles 14-18): This is like the rulebook that says everyone is equal. No matter where you’re from, what your religion is, or what your background is, the law treats everyone the same. It’s all about fairness and equal opportunities, especially in jobs.
